Castle Lodge, 324 Portswood Road. Definitely an unusual sight. This post is linked to previous posts of St Mary’s, South Stoneham.
The Lodge 324 Portswood Road,1940 and recently. Sometimes called Castle Lodge, it was built c1780 for General Stibbert, as an entrance lodge to Portswood House. Portswood House (third picture) stood just to the north of the present day Lawn Road; it was demolished in 1852.
Stibbert died in 1809, and was buried in St Mary’s Church, South Stoneham, where a memorial plaque erected by his eldest son, Thomas, can still be seen. By pure coincidence, I have just posted about St Mary’s!
